    Such a simple incident involves all aspects of society. Manipulation, hype, exaggeration and distortion of facts by the media; numbness and blindness in society, which are easily misled out of context; more and more people watch the fun and take the opportunity to make a fortune and promote their own interests. . All this finally drove Sam to a dead end. The role of the female intern fully demonstrates the ruthless hypocrisy of the media. She always had a smile on her face and was indifferent to Sam and the hostage situation
